Dysarthria is a motor speech disorder caused by weakness or paralysis of the muscles used for speech. The following areas of speech may be impaired: articulation, rate, volume, prosody and respiratory support. The speech of an individual suffering from dysarthria sounds slurred and is very difficult to understand. Dysarthria is the result of damage to the central or peripheral nervous system.

Common causes include:

  • stroke
  • brain tumor
  • head trauma
  • neuromuscular diseases
